#a8d600 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a8d600 is composed of 65.9% red, 83.9%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 72.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 42%. #a8d600 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#51ad00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

#a8d600 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a8d600 has RGB values of R:168, G:214,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:1,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 11064832.

Shades and Tints of #a8d600
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e1200 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a8d600
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707363 is the less saturated color, while #a8d600 is the most saturated one.
